The Processing Path of Raw Soybean Liquid
The transformation of raw soybean oil is a lengthy procedure, involving several crucial stages. Initially, the soybeans are sorted and shelled to remove any foreign material. Subsequently, the beans undergo extraction—either mechanical pressing to yield oil or a solvent extraction method using chemicals. The obtained crude oil then enters a refining sequence. This typically includes degumming, to remove phospholipids; neutralization, which eliminates free fatty acids; bleaching, to lighten the oil; and deodorization, removing odor and taste compounds. In conclusion, the refined soybean oil is chilled and bottled for distribution.
